  • Page 7 With this function, the operating noise of the outdoor unit can be lowered by reducing the operation load, for example, during nighttime in COOL mode. However, please note that the cooling and heating capacity may lower if this function is activated. * Changing the setting is required to activate this function. Please explain about this function to your customers and ask them whether they want to use it. [How to lower the operating noise] ) Be sure to turn off the main power for the air conditioner before making the setting. 2) Set the “3” of SW on the outdoor controller board to ON to enable this function. 3) Turn on the main power for the air conditioner.     4-6. TEST RUN • Test runs of the indoor units should be performed individually. See the installation manual coming with the indoor unit, and make sure all the units oper- ate properly. • If the test run with all the units is performed at once, possible erroneous connections of the refrigerant pipes and the indoor/outdoor unit connecting wires cannot be detected. Thus, be sure to perform the test run one by one. About the restart protective mechanism Once the compressor stops, the restart preventive device operates so the compressor will not operate for 3 minutes to protect the air conditioner. Wiring/piping correction function This unit has a wiring/piping correction function which corrects wiring and piping combination. When there is possibility of incorrect wiring and piping combi- nation, and confirming the combination is difficult, use this function to detect and correct the combination by following the procedures below. Make sure that the following is done. • Power is supplied to the unit. • Stop valves are open. Note: During detection, the operation of the indoor unit is controlled by the outdoor unit. During detection, the indoor unit automatically stops operation. This is not a malfunction. Procedure Press the piping/wiring correction switch (SW87)  minute or more after turning on the power supply. LED indication during detection: • Correction completes in 0 to 5 minutes. When the correction is completed, its result is shown by LED indication.
